How to Choose the Right Electronic Design Company?
Electronic design and electronic assembly are specialties that when combined allow an electronics contract manufacturer take your products from initial specification to a completed production ready prototype. In addition to electronic contract manufacturing, you will want to look for a company providing both hardware and software electronic design services.
Be sure there are Warranty and Repair Services available for any of the electronic assemblies designed and built.
You should be able to find turnkey solutions that can become an extension of your company. A partner that can provide engineering services allowing you to concentrate on your core competencies. In addition, value should be added by providing you with ongoing engineering design support through the product life cycle.
You want an electronic design company to consistently produce cost effective high quality electronic designs and solutions that meet your exact specifications and delivery requirements. Consistency in the ability to provide highly reliable solutions is also vital in your selection of an electron design company.
Remember to consider these questions when choosing an electronic design company:
- What is the process for parts procurement?
- Can they provide complete system assembly?
- Will they review the designs for the ability to manufacture?
- What is the company’s level of consistency for on time delivery and quality?
- Will you have a direct point of contact or a designated project engineer?
- Are they able to provide product testing?
- What happens once a project is completed, do they offer continuing engineering?
- Do they have a proven quality assurance system in place?
- How in sync is the hardware & software design with the manufacturing process?
